Re: 95 ezgo txt
Verify that Pin-4 has voltage on it with F/R in R, but not when in F.
Then check the polarity of the controller's F1 and F2 terminals with F/R in F and in R by connecting a voltmeter across them. For example F1 will either be + or - when in F and the the opposite polarity when in R. In a nutshell, if the voltage on Pin-4 comes and goes when F/R is switched from R to F, but the polarity of the F terminals doesn't change, the controller is bad. |
